全国用户服务热线

您的位置:主页 > 最新动态

检索管理系统在电子商务中的应用及性能优化

发布日期:2024-03-02 浏览:9次

随着互联网和电子商务的不断发展,检索管理系统在电子商务中发挥着重要的作用。它通过对大量的商品信息进行统一归类、存储和检索,帮助用户快速找到所需的商品,提升用户体验,并为电商平台带来更多商机。

一、检索管理系统在电子商务中的应用

1. 单一商品快速检索:电子商务平台上通常存在大量商品,如果没有检索管理系统,用户将难以快速找到所需的商品。检索管理系统通过在商品信息中建立索引,用户可以根据关键字、品牌、价格等条件进行检索,从而极大地提高了商品检索的效率。

2. 跨类目商品关联性推荐:检索管理系统可以通过分析用户的搜索行为和购买记录,了解用户的偏好和兴趣,从而提供个性化的商品推荐。通过关联性推荐算法,系统可以根据用户的搜索历史,向用户推荐真正感兴趣的商品,提升用户购物的满意度。

3. 搜索结果排序:在电子商务平台上,同一类别的商品经常有多个卖家,用户需要根据一定的权重进行排序,以便选择最优的商品。检索管理系统通过考虑商品的价格、销量、评价等因素进行排序,帮助用户更好地选择商品。

二、检索管理系统的性能优化

1. 建立有效的索引系统:检索管理系统的性能优化的关键在于建立有效的索引系统。索引系统需要根据商品的特性,选择合适的数据结构和算法,并根据实际情况对其进行优化。同时,为了提高检索速度,可以使用分布式索引系统,将数据分散存储在多台服务器上,并利用并行计算的能力提高检索效率。

2. 采用高效的检索算法:对于检索管理系统来说,检索算法是关键。高效的检索算法可以提高检索效率,减少系统的负载。常见的检索算法包括倒排索引、布隆过滤器等,可以根据实际需求选择合适的算法,并对其进行优化。

3. 数据预处理和缓存机制:为了减少用户请求对数据库的频繁访问,可以使用数据预处理技术,将常用的商品信息进行缓存。同时,通过设置缓存有效期和淘汰策略,可以更好地利用缓存资源,提高系统的性能。

4. 异步处理和分布式架构:为了提高系统的吞吐量和并发能力,可以引入异步处理和分布式架构。异步处理可以将一些耗时的操作放到后台进行,保证用户请求的响应速度;分布式架构可以将系统的负载分散到多个服务器上,提高系统的并发处理能力。

总之,检索管理系统在电子商务中具有广泛的应用,通过优化检索算法、建立高效的索引系统和采用缓存机制等方法,可以提升系统的性能,为用户提供更好的购物体验。随着技术的不断发展,相信检索管理系统在电子商务中的应用将会不断创新,并给用户带来更加便捷的购物体验。
主页 QQ 微信 电话
展开